Mysuru, Aug. 31 -- A social media reel filmed inside the Mysuru City Police Commissioner's Office premises at Nazarbad has gone viral, sparking public debate over enforcement lapses and accountability.
Despite clear restrictions on photo and video shoots near sensitive landmarks - including heritage buildings and the Mysore Palace - a couple was spotted recording a reel within the high-security premises of Commissioner's Office.
The video has raised serious questions about protocol breaches and the apparent double standards in implementing guidelines.
